He has to groom someone to be the backup. Our starting QB has either been yanked (Lee), subbed in and out (Lee and JJ), or injured from a series to an entire game (Mett) in each of the last three seasons. Would we trust a walk-on in that spot?

Jennings played in 7 games last year before being forced to play for a reason. He was young and needed reps after leapfrogging the older but less talented competition. And it turned out to be valuable and necessary experience at the end of the season. Harris should be no different. They need to get him as many snaps as they can to prepare him, QB battle or not.

To expect Harris to suddenly explode past Jennings is unrealistic after camp. It could happen, but camp and spring practice is where the reps get split and the coaches look to groom and work on technique. Harris definitely wasn't ready to be the starter Saturday night, and as such, he isn't going to be getting the starter's reps in practice unless Jennings gets hurt. That puts him at a disadvantage to leapfrog Jennings this season. I'm not saying it can't happen, but it will not be easy for him. Next year- different story.
